Choice-Of-Law Clause On Distribution Contract Upheld
In an action filed by Andina Licores S.A. (“Andina”), an Ecuadorian corporation, against E & J. Gallo Winery (“Gallo”), one of the largest wineries from California, the Second Civil Court of Guayaquil found that it lacked jurisdiction to hear the dispute because both parties had agreed in their distribution contract that their controversies must be heard by a California court and in accordance to California law.

Oil Production VAT Claims Rejected
To avoid the exportation of indirect taxes, Article 69(a) of the Internal Tax Regime Law recognizes the right to a refund for value added tax (VAT) paid on the importation and local acquisition of goods and services used for the production of export goods. Based on this legal provision, companies with upstream contracts have claimed from the Internal Revenue Service a refund of the VAT paid on the production of the oil they produce and export.

Anti-counterfeiting in the Republic of Ecuador
Despite the existence of national and Andean Community legislation protecting intellectual property rights as well as the adhesion by Ecuador to key international conventions on intellectual and industrial property rights, such as the Agreement on Trade-Related aspects of Intellectual Property (the TRIPS Agreement), Ecuador remains one of the countries in the region with the most prolific rates of piracy.
